Installing a Sprinkler System: Costs, Permits & Planning

Embarking on a setup of a irrigation sprinkler setup can significantly boost your property’s beauty, but requires careful planning. Initial prices can range from roughly $800 for a basic system to over $5,000 for a complex one, depending on factors like extent of the property, number of sections, and type of emitters selected. Don't forgetting potential approvals, which are usually required by your municipal council and may require costs of $50 to $200. Careful planning including evaluating water flow, soil sort, and sunlight exposure is crucial for maximizing effectiveness and avoiding issues later.

Sprinkler System Installation for Beginners: Tools & Techniques

Getting started with a new lawn network setup can feel tricky, but with the essential tools and simple techniques, it's completely achievable. You’ll use the range of equipment, including the shovel, the pipe cutter, a plastic tubing spanner , plus a measuring device . Careful digging requires creating ditches for the pipes, generally approximately 6 to 8 inches deep. After installing the tubing , ensure they're correctly connected with necessary fittings and subsequently check the system for leaks before programming the automation system.
